As an Assistant Business Support Accountant, you will play a key role in providing expert support and analysis for the Council's services. This role primarily supports the Housing Revenue Account (HRA), Shared Revenues Partnership (SRP) and other key support services. You assist a Business Support Accountant to help ensure the Council meets its financial obligations, key objectives and critical deadlines.
We will be looking to appoint to either level depending on skills and experience.
If appointed to level 1 the council requires that you be working towards obtaining the Association of Accounting Technicians (AAT). Full study support will be provided within the fixed contract term to enable you to continue your studies.
If appointed to the level 2 of the career grade we expect you to be a member of the Association of Accounting Technicians (AAT) or relevant financial NVQ level 4 and above.
You will support Business Support Accountants with the council's monthly budget monitoring process. As well as being a trusted advisor by providing high quality budgetary advice to the services you will support to create a real and active working relationships with both operational and management.
